The United States and Europe dispersing agent market for gloss emulsion paints has been experiencing steady growth due to the increasing demand for high-quality, environmentally friendly coatings. The shift toward water-based and low-VOC gloss emulsion paints, combined with stringent environmental regulations, has fueled the need for advanced dispersing agents that enhance paint stability, color development, and gloss retention. With the construction industry expanding and technological innovations in coatings advancing, the demand for efficient dispersing agents is rising in both North America and Europe.
United States: Market Growth and Emerging Trends
In the United States, the dispersing agent market for gloss emulsion paints is expanding rapidly, driven by rising infrastructure development, home renovation activities, and sustainability regulations. The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) has introduced strict VOC emission norms, pushing paint manufacturers to transition from solvent-based coatings to water-based formulations. This shift has increased the production and demand for dispersing agents, ensuring better pigment dispersion, stability, and application efficiency in gloss emulsion paints.
The residential and commercial painting sectors in the U.S. are growing, as more consumers and businesses opt for high-performance, long-lasting gloss finishes. The DIY paint market is also on the rise, further driving the need for dispersing agents that improve ease of application and color consistency. Major manufacturers in the U.S. are investing in R&D to develop advanced dispersing agent formulations, focusing on bio-based and sustainable chemistries. Key states such as California, Texas, and Florida are leading the demand due to strong housing markets, urbanization, and eco-friendly construction initiatives.
Additionally, automotive and industrial coatings are adopting water-based gloss paints, further driving the need for high-performance dispersing agents. The United States serves as a major exporter of dispersing agents, supplying to Europe, Latin America, and Asia, solidifying its role as a global production hub.
Europe: Country-Wise Market Developments and Business Opportunities
The European dispersing agent market for gloss emulsion paints is witnessing rapid expansion, driven by stringent environmental policies, sustainable coatings demand, and advanced coatings technologies. The European Union’s REACH regulations mandate the use of low-VOC, eco-friendly paint additives, increasing the demand for high-performance dispersing agents. Different European countries have unique market drivers, shaping regional business opportunities and production capabilities.
Germany: Leading Production Hub for High-Performance Dispersing Agents
Germany remains the largest market for dispersing agent production, thanks to its strong coatings industry, advanced polymer research, and regulatory focus on sustainability. The country’s robust industrial and automotive sectors further drive demand for high-quality gloss emulsion paints, requiring specialized dispersing agents for enhanced stability and dispersion efficiency. With leading chemical manufacturers based in Germany, the country continues to export dispersing agents to other European markets and globally. Investments in green chemistry and bio-based dispersing agents are rising, ensuring sustainable production growth.

The Asia Pacific dispersing agent market for gloss emulsion paints is experiencing robust growth, driven by rising construction activities, increasing adoption of water-based coatings, and the expansion of the paint and coatings industry. With growing environmental awareness and stricter regulations regarding VOC emissions, the demand for low-VOC, eco-friendly gloss emulsion paints is increasing across the region. This shift has led to greater production of dispersing agents, which play a crucial role in enhancing paint stability, pigment dispersion, and gloss retention. Countries such as China, India, Japan, South Korea, and Australia are leading in dispersing agent production, while emerging markets in Southeast Asia present significant business opportunities for local and international manufacturers.
China: The Largest Producer and Consumer of Dispersing Agents
China remains the dominant player in the Asia Pacific dispersing agent market for gloss emulsion paints, with its large-scale paint and coatings industry driving strong demand. The country’s rapid urbanization, booming infrastructure projects, and rising middle-class population have increased the consumption of high-quality gloss paints, leading to higher production of dispersing agents. Additionally, government regulations on VOC emissions are encouraging paint manufacturers to shift toward water-based formulations, boosting the need for efficient dispersing agents.
China’s strong manufacturing base and abundant raw materials give it a cost advantage, making it a major exporter of dispersing agents to Southeast Asia, the Middle East, and Africa. Leading Chinese chemical companies are investing in advanced dispersing technologies, including bio-based and high-performance polymer dispersing agents, to cater to the growing demand for sustainable gloss emulsion paints.

Dispersing Agent for Gloss Emulsion Paints: Global Production and Import-Export Scenario
The global dispersing agent market for gloss emulsion paints is witnessing significant growth due to rising construction activities, increasing demand for water-based coatings, and stringent environmental regulations promoting low-VOC paints. Dispersing agents play a crucial role in improving the stability, uniformity, and gloss retention of emulsion paints, making them essential in the production of high-quality coatings. The production and trade of dispersing agents are heavily influenced by regional industrial policies, availability of raw materials, technological advancements, and consumer demand for eco-friendly coatings.
Global Production Trends and Major Manufacturing Hubs
The production of dispersing agents for gloss emulsion paints is concentrated in regions with strong chemical manufacturing capabilities, abundant raw material supplies, and advanced research in polymer chemistry. The leading producers are North America (United States), Europe (Germany, France, and the UK), and Asia-Pacific (China, India, Japan, and South Korea). These regions have established high-capacity production facilities, ensuring a steady supply of dispersing agents to both domestic and export markets.
North America: Technological Leadership in High-Performance Dispersing Agents
The United States and Canada are major producers and exporters of high-performance dispersing agents, benefiting from their well-established chemical industries and advanced R&D capabilities. The presence of leading paint and coatings manufacturers, such as Sherwin-Williams and PPG Industries, has fueled the demand for specialized dispersing agents. The U.S. remains a key exporter to regions such as Latin America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ific, offering high-quality, low-VOC dispersing agents tailored for water-based gloss paints.
With strict EPA regulations on VOC emissions, U.S. manufacturers are focusing on bio-based and sustainable dispersing agents, ensuring compliance with environmental standards in key export markets. The growth of green buildings and smart coatings in the U.S. is further driving domestic dispersing agent production, making the country a leader in innovation-driven coatings technology.
Europe: Strong Internal Trade and Sustainable Production
Germany, France, and the UK are at the forefront of dispersing agent production in Europe, driven by advanced coatings technology and stringent EU environmental policies. The European Union’s REACH regulations have accelerated the shift toward low-VOC and sustainable coatings, creating a high demand for dispersing agents tailored for water-based gloss paints.
Germany remains Europe’s largest producer and exporter of specialty dispersing agents, supplying to markets across the EU, Asia, and North America. France and the UK also have strong domestic production, supported by leading chemical manufacturers that focus on developing innovative dispersing solutions for high-performance gloss coatings. The European market is characterized by strong internal trade, with dispersing agents being imported and exported among EU member states based on specific formulation requirements.
